Its the learning where the real money is.

Cheap ones take ages to learn whereas the expensive ones are pretty accurate but still return a list of up to 10 possibles.

Its amazing technology, its fascinated me since we started putting the IVR in.

My mother has successfully used Dragon for a number of years (she has severe rheumatiod arthritis and therefore cannot type up her PHD thesis). Unfortunatley she does have the habit of talking to the computer as if its a person "I'll just get that phone, be back in a minute" appears numerous times in the essays before correction.
